加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.zhandada.cn/)- 应用程序、大数据、数据可视化、人脸识别、低代码!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

ASP进阶实战:硬核逻辑与高阶开发秘籍

发布时间:2026-04-25 11:51:13 所属栏目:Asp教程 来源:DaWei
导读:  ASP(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代开发中已被更先进的框架所取代,但其核心理念和逻辑结构仍然具有重要的学习价值。掌握ASP的进阶技巧,能够帮助开发者理解动态网页生成的基本原

  ASP(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代开发中已被更先进的框架所取代,但其核心理念和逻辑结构仍然具有重要的学习价值。掌握ASP的进阶技巧,能够帮助开发者理解动态网页生成的基本原理。


  在ASP开发中,硬核逻辑往往体现在对请求处理、数据流控制以及错误处理的精细把控上。例如,合理使用Request对象获取用户输入,并通过Response对象进行响应输出,是构建交互式网页的基础。同时,利用Session和Application对象管理用户状态和全局变量,可以提升应用的性能与用户体验。


  高阶开发中,代码的组织与可维护性尤为重要。将业务逻辑与显示层分离,采用函数或组件化的方式编写代码,不仅有助于提高代码复用率,还能降低后期维护成本。合理使用ASP内置对象如Server、ObjectContext等,可以实现更复杂的业务场景。


  在实际项目中,安全问题不容忽视。避免SQL注入、跨站脚本攻击(XSS)等常见漏洞,需要开发者具备良好的编码习惯和防御意识。例如,对用户输入进行严格的校验和过滤,使用参数化查询代替字符串拼接,都是保障系统安全的关键步骤。


AI分析图,仅供参考

  随着技术的发展,ASP虽已不是主流选择,但其背后的编程思想和设计模式仍值得深入研究。对于希望理解Web开发底层机制的开发者而言,ASP的进阶实战无疑是一条有价值的探索路径。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章